Homeobox protein NKX6-3 (NKX6-3)

Target
NKX6-3
Molecular classification
Transcription factor, Homeobox protein
01

Overview

Homeobox protein NKX6-3 is a member of the NK6 subfamily of homeobox transcription factors characterized by a homeodomain that binds DNA to regulate gene transcription. It is expressed in the developing central nervous system and gastrointestinal tract, where it plays a role in the patterning and differentiation of neural and epithelial cells. NKX6-3 is implicated in the negative regulation of gastric mucosal atrophy and inflammatory signaling, which links it to roles in cancer and inflammatory conditions of the gut. However, it is primarily considered a developmental transcription factor rather than a classic therapeutic target such as a receptor or enzyme.
